Boost Your Harvest: Organic Gardening Essentials

To achieve a generous harvest organically, several vital elements are necessary. First, robust soil is critical; consider adding compost and vermicompost to nourish it. Next, pick pest-free plant varieties suited to your local climate. Finally, focus on biological pest control methods like companion planting, introducing predatory creatures, and using natural remedies when needed.

Growing Naturally: News & Breakthroughs in the Yard

The world of organic gardening is continually evolving, with new techniques and methods emerging regularly. We're seeing increased interest in no-dig farming, which minimizes soil disturbance to improve plant health and reduce erosion. Advanced composting systems, like vermicomposting (worm farming) and Bokashi fermentation, are offering efficient ways to manage kitchen scraps and create nutrient-rich soil amendments. Furthermore, the use of beneficial insects, or biocontrol agents, is gaining popularity as a eco-friendly alternative to chemical pesticides, helping gardeners defend their plants while supporting local ecosystems. Researchers are also exploring heritage seed varieties and focusing on drought-resistant cultivars to address the challenges of climate change, making organic practices increasingly resilient and accessible.

Leading Chemical-free Gardening Practices from Expert Gardeners

To truly elevate your plot's performance, learn here directly from the professionals! Experienced horticulturists consistently leverage several key techniques. Firstly, embrace cover cropping , a process that enhances earth quality and suppresses weeds. Secondly, composting isn't just a suggestion—it’s an absolute necessity for creating rich, nutrient-dense compost. They also frequently employ crop rotation to prevent soil depletion and pest build-up. Finally, meticulous attention to beneficial insects, like attracting lacewings , is paramount; they naturally control unwanted critters reducing the need for any intervention . By adopting these proven strategies, you can achieve a truly thriving and bountiful flower area.
